Transaction 2698cd29602adedc4ac3593a6318a1b012e7811178e2d96744bf8c64d0f12416
1 Input
1 Output
-
2698cd29602adedc4ac3593a6318a1b012e7811178e2d96744bf8c64d0f12416:0
- value
- 49164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3a268044577251fbdf0ed626c195bc58da48bb6 OP_EQUAL
- address
- 3PuEgM64ejRT5u8uSrLkQahzztvQMM59qW